- The distance between Kirensk, Russia and Akune, Japan is approximately 3,317 km or 2,061 mi.
- To reach Kirensk in this distance one would set out from Akune bearing 336.2°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Kirensk bearing 320.1° or NW .
- Kirensk has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c) whereas Akune has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Kirensk is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Akune is in or near the warm temperate wet for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 21.1 °C (38°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 25.1 °C (45.2°F) more in Kirensk.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to semicont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1688.2 mm (66.5 in) less which is equivalent to 1688.2 l/m² (41.43 US gal/ft²) or 16,882,000 l/ha (1,804,798 US gal/ac) less. About 1/5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 25.7° lower in Kirensk than in Akune.
- Relative humidity levels are 1.3%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 20.6°C (37°F) lower.
